[发明专利]一种用单芯片串行FLASH提高打印速度的方法和装置无效
| 申请号: | 201210160442.3 | 申请日: | 2012-05-23 |
| 公开(公告)号: | CN102658733A | 公开(公告)日: | 2012-09-12 |
| 发明(设计)人: | 杨亮;陈彦水;邓薇薇 | 申请(专利权)人: | 天津浩镛科技发展有限公司 |
| 主分类号: | B41J29/38 | 分类号: | B41J29/38;G06F3/12 |
| 代理公司: | 天津滨海科纬知识产权代理有限公司 12211 | 代理人: | 李莉华 |
| 地址: | 300020 天津市和*** | 国省代码: | 天津;12 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 芯片 串行 flash 提高 打印 速度 方法 装置 | ||
技术领域
本发明属于微型打印控制领域,尤其是涉及一种用单芯片串行FLASH提高打印速度的方法和装置。
背景技术
目前微型打印机广泛使用在各个行业,比如仪器仪表、超级市场、邮政、银行、烟草专卖、公用事业抄表、移动警务系统、移动政务系统等等。现在市面上有很多中微型打印机,各自都有自己的适用范围。微型打印机包含很多种,按打印方式分有针式微型打印机、热敏微型打印机、热转印微型打印机还有微型字模打印机。这些打印机的构造主要由放纸室、电源、传动装置、走纸装置、切纸装置、打印装置、控制装置组成。各装置的协调工作主要依赖于控制装置的协调操作,来保证正常运行。同时,控制装置也是提高微型打印机工作效率的重要部件。
国内使用的微型打印机控制装置主要使用的是国外品牌和国内其他厂商品牌。以热敏打印机为例:热敏打印机在工作时,功耗主要来自一下两个方面:
(1)打印功耗:进纸、打印头加热、切刀等行为产生的功耗称之为打印功耗。打印功耗的大小取决于打印机设定的打印深度、打印速度、打印内容等。在使用相同型号的打印头时,进口产品、国产产品和RTP产品几乎相同。
(2)待机功耗:打印机控制装置在待机状态下产生的功耗称之为待机功耗。待机功耗主要受打印机控制装置影响。
国外的品牌拥有质量好、功能全的优点,但是价格高、打印功耗与待机功耗高,造成用户的生产成本大幅增加。反观国内的品牌,虽然做到了价格适中,但是却又出现了打印速度慢、体积大、质量一般、功能少的缺点,使得用户的研发方面增加投入,同样导致用户的成本增加。
在现有技术中,一般在微型打印控制装置中使用主控芯片并行连接外扩FLASH存储器和多个并行SDRAM。存在电子原件数量多、执行速度慢、成本大幅增加且导致整个控制装置外形、体积较大等技术问题。
发明内容
微型打印机控制装置是用来实现与微型打印机的上位机的通信、协调微型打印机内的打印装置、走纸装置、切纸装置等各功能部件的协调工作,最终实现上位机的打印需求。本发明要解决的问题是提供一种功耗低、噪音低、速度快、可靠性高、打印字符清晰等优点的微型打印控制装置,尤其适合基于全指令集单芯片串行FLASH的微型打印机控制装置。
为解决上述技术问题,本发明采用的技术方案是:提供一种用单芯片串行FLASH提高打印速度的方法和装置,其中方法的控制步骤为:
步骤一:通信控制器控制打印命令和/或打印数据通过通信接口存入主控芯片的打印缓冲区;
步骤二:判断缓冲区的数据是否写满,写满则输出流量控制信号等待数据处理;
步骤三:提取打印缓冲区的打印命令和打印数据;
步骤四:判断读取的数据是否为打印命令,如果是打印命令则执行打印命令;否则执行子步骤五;
步骤五:判断打印数据是否是位图数据,如果是位图数据则将点信息放入打印缓冲区然后进行排版;否则执行子步骤六;
步骤六:判断是否是内码数据,如果是内码数据则调用外扩FLASH的字库,在打印缓冲区中进行字库点阵读取、排版;否则执行步骤七;
步骤七:判断是否放弃打印,如果同意放弃则回到初始化状态,否则执行打印逻辑处理;
步骤八:打印逻辑处理依次控制电机控制器走纸、打印控制器打印、控制电机控制器切纸,最终完成打印步骤。
所述执行单芯片串行FLASH提高打印速度的控制方法的微型打印机控制装置,包括通信接口、主控芯片、外扩FLASH存储器、电机控制器、打印控制器,其中主控芯片包括用于接收或发送数据的通信控制器;设置有打印缓冲区的RAM存储器,是用于存储程序运行时变量、堆栈、打印数据的存储区;用于存放执行程序的FLASH存储器;FLASH控制器,FLASH控制器串行连接外扩FLASH存储器,FLASH控制器对外扩FLASH存储器进行读取和/或写入操作;通信控制器将数据通过通信接口读入RAM存储器;电机控制器与主控芯片连接,进行走纸和切纸控制;主控芯片对打印控制器进行打印控制。作用在于:通过主控芯片内部的程序实现高速串行通信,完成对外扩FLASH数据的读取功能。最大限度的减少了外部设备,提高集成度、节约成本、进一步降低功耗。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于天津浩镛科技发展有限公司,未经天津浩镛科技发展有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210160442.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:采用数据输入输出管理控制的电子装置
- 下一篇:用于动态数据存储的系统及方法





